ASTM Condition 2
“This is a set of conditions for the operation of a bicycle that
includes Condition1 as well as unpaved and gravel roads and trails
withmoderate grades. Contact with irregular terrain and loss of tire
contact with the ground may occur. Jumps should be limited to 30cm
(12in.) or less.”

INTENDED
For paved roads, gravel or dirt roads that are in good condition, and
bike paths.
NOT INTENDED
For o-road or mountain bike use, or for any kind of jumping.
Some of these bikes have suspension features, but these features are
designed to add comfort, not o-road capability. Some come with
relatively wide tires that are well suited to gravel or dirt paths. Some
come with relatively narrow tires that are best suited to faster riding
on pavement. If you ride on gravel or dirt paths, carry heavier loads
or want more tire durability talk to your dealer about wider tires.
